Trump says he'll speak at "A Salute To America" event on July 4 at D.C.'s Lincoln Memorial

President Trump announced that he plans to speak at an Independence Day event at the Lincoln Memorial in Washington, D.C. in a Sunday morning tweet.

"HOLD THE DATE! We will be having one of the biggest gatherings in the history of Washington, D.C., on July 4th. It will be called 'A Salute To America' and will be held at the Lincoln Memorial. Major fireworks display, entertainment and an address by your favorite President, me!"

The backdrop: Trump first floated this idea during a Cabinet meeting earlier this month. He has long expressed interest in a similar, large-scale event in the nation's capital, proposing a military parade last year for Veterans Day before axing it after pushback from local politicians over costs.
